
Cooler Master has launched the GX II Gold series, a new lineup of ATX 3.0 power supplies that feature a 12VHPWR connector for delivering power to the GeForce RTX 4090 and other modern NVIDIA graphics cards. Available in 850- and 750-watt output capacities, these new fully modular PSUs come with a 90-degree 12+4-pin 12VHPWR PCIe 5.0 connector that, according to marketing materials, prevents cable wear and enables improved safety. Users will also find a zero-RPM mode for silent operation at lower temperatures/power loads.
Cooler Master GX II Gold PSU Features
- 80 PLUS Gold certification: The GX II Gold is certified to achieve more than 90% efficiency at typical loads.
- ATX 3.0 support: ATX 3.0 compatibility and a 12VHPWR connector enable peak power support up to 200% more than the unit’s rated power.
- Smart thermal control mode: A zero-RPM default mode automatically activates the fan when your PC reaches a specific temperature.
- Fully modular cabling: Efficiently reduces clutter, increases airflow, and improves overall efficiency and thermal performance.
- 10-year warranty: This unit comes with a standard limited manufacturing warranty of 10 years from the date of purchase.
The GX II Gold comes fully loaded with an APFC half-bridge, LLC, and DC-to-DC design, achieving an 80 Plus Gold efficiency certification while maintaining exceptional performance. A smart thermal control mode and zero-RPM default mode effectively minimize noise and enhance heat dissipation, while an ATX 3.0 12VHPWR native cable featuring a space-saving 90-degree connector ensures flexible compatibility with the latest GPUs.
